Mouser for the cores.

I recommend RG-400. It has a stranded center conductor vice the RG-142,
which is a solid conductor. RG-400 is easier to wind and stays put.

Make sure you look for some RG-400 at Dayton. There is always some
there. Sans that, check eBay or the swap sites QRZ and QTH.
